A mechanical assembly that houses and drives oscillating blades for precise foam cutting in upholstery manufacturing.
Technical details and manufacturing context for Oscillating Blade Assembly
| Parameter | Typical range | Notes & selection driver |
|---|---|---|
| Blade Length | 150–300 mm | Determines maximum foam thickness that can be cut. |
| Blade Width | 10–25 mm | Affects cutting stability and edge quality. |
| Blade Thickness | 0.5–1.5 mm | Thicker blades for heavy-duty cutting, thinner for precision. |
| Oscillation Frequency | 1000–3000 Hz | Higher frequency improves cut quality but increases wear. |
| Oscillation Amplitude | 2–8 mm | Affects cutting speed and foam compression. |
| Cutting Speed | 5–30 m/min | Maximum linear speed for clean cuts. |
| Positioning Accuracy | ±0.1 mm | Ensures consistent cut dimensions.ISO 230-2 |
| Repeatability | ±0.05 mm | Critical for batch production consistency.ISO 230-2 |
| Operating Voltage | 24 ±10% V DC | Common for industrial control systems. |
| Power Consumption | 50–200 W | Depends on blade size and oscillation frequency. |
| Operating Temperature | 0–40 °C | Outside this range, performance may degrade. |
| Relative Humidity | 30–80 % | Non-condensing; higher humidity may cause corrosion. |
| Ingress Protection | IP54–IP65 | IP65 for dusty environments.IEC 60529 |
| Blade Material | 65Mn | Spring steel for durability and sharpness.GB/T 1222 |
| Weight | 5–15 kg | Affects mounting and portability. |

Rotational input from the motor is converted to oscillating motion via a cam mechanism or eccentric bearing arrangement. This allows the blades to move back and forth at high frequency while maintaining alignment and tension.
